Dropshipping Payments
Payment is one of the key aspects of dropshipping. Dropshippers need to choose a payment gateway that is secure and convenient for their customers. Here are some of the most popular payment gateways for dropshippers.
1. PayPal: PayPal is one of the most widely used payment gateways. It is available in more than 203 countries and supports all major credit cards. Merchants need to have a business PayPal account to start dropshipping. There is a 3.49% + $0.49 (fixed) payment processing fee.
2. Stripe: Stripe is a US-based payment gateway that’s available in more than 25 countries. It supports all major credit cards and charges a 2.9% + $0.30 per successful transaction.
3. 2Checkout: 2Checkout is available in more than 87 countries and supports all major credit cards. It offers several payment processing packages with different pricing models.
4. Authorize.net: Authorize.net is available in more than 33 countries and accepts all major credit cards. It charges a 2.9% + 0.30 per successful transaction and a monthly fixed fee of $25 regardless of the package.
5. Apple Pay: Apple Pay is a contactless payment gateway that is widely used in many countries. It charges a payment processing fee of 2.9% + 0.30 per successful transaction.
By choosing the right payment gateway, you can ensure secure and convenient payments for your dropshipping store.
